Standard Gain Horn Antenna 15dBi Typ. Gain, 0.95-1.45 GHz Frequency Range RM-SGHA770-15

Short Description:

RF MISO’s Model RM-SGHA770-15 is a linear polarized standard gain horn antenna that operates from 0.95 to 1.45 GHz. The antenna offers a typical gain of 15 dBi and low VSWR 1.2:1. This antenna has flange input and coaxial input.Please contact RF Miso for details.

  • The Standard Gain Horn Antenna is a precision-calibrated microwave device serving as the fundamental reference in antenna measurement systems. Its design follows classical electromagnetic theory, featuring a precisely flared rectangular or circular waveguide structure that ensures predictable and stable radiation characteristics.

    Key Technical Features:

    • Frequency Specificity: Each horn is optimized for a specific frequency band (e.g., 18-26.5 GHz)

    • High Calibration Accuracy: Typical gain tolerance of ±0.5 dB across operational band

    • Excellent Impedance Matching: VSWR typically <1.25:1

    • Well-Defined Pattern: Symmetric E- and H-plane radiation patterns with low sidelobes

    Primary Applications:

    1. Gain calibration standard for antenna test ranges

    2. Reference antenna for EMC/EMI testing

    3. Feed element for parabolic reflectors

    4. Educational tool in electromagnetic laboratories

    These antennas are manufactured under strict quality control, with their gain values traceable to national measurement standards. Their predictable performance makes them indispensable for verifying the performance of other antenna systems and measurement equipment.
